Default Show blank when today() is within a certain date range

I have a date in cell C90.
I need a formula in K90 that keeps the cell blank when the month of today()
does not exceed 1 full month after the month in C90. Eg, if the date in C90
is 3rd Jan 07 and the month of today() is up to and including Feb, I want the
cell to be blank. As soon as the month of today() = March, then I want a
figure to be shown, i.e. I want to be able to perform my getpivotdata
function.

Any ideas?
